ONE ON ONE INTERVIEW WITH TANZANIAN BASED IN NEW YORK ''''JOHNSON LUJWANGANA''' OF GROWING UP AFRICAN SERIES..



 
 Seif Kabelele: Tell those who don’t know about you,your background in brief..
Johnson Lujwangana: My name is Johnson Lujwangana, I was born in Kibaha au Dar and I grew up in 
                                 Bukoba. Since like age 3 or 4 I was raised by my grandmother, well two grandmothers 
                                 but my favorite was my grandmother's sister. She had no kids but she took care of all  
                                of  us while my mom was still in the U.S. Right now am 25 years old and just living day  
                                to day. I   attended boarding school in UGANDA for five years and been in New York 
                                since 98.
